The Solution Architect is responsible for designing the best-fit solution which addresses business, technical, people and commercial requirements for both the client and Accenture. Solution Architects mainly support pre-sales efforts, sitting as part of the wider Deal Team. They work closely with sales, technical/business functions, delivery and commercial functions, to run the Solution through the Accenture Sales process.

Main responsibilities will include:
- Development and ownership of the complex solutions underpinning compelling proposals that maximise Accenture’s competitive position.
- An ability to effectively engage with internal teams to leverage industry best-practices and innovative thinking.
- Setting the direction of each opportunity pursuit, including developing the solution strategy in close consultation with the Sales lead and respective Deal Team.
- Articulation of the solution in a clear and concise manner catering to internal or external audiences where applicable.
- Ensuring alignment of the solution to the client’s objectives and success criteria.
- Collaborate with other architects including delivery, mobilization, technology etc., to plan and architect the overall delivery architecture and capabilities and produce a coherent solution.
- Relationship management with customers and partners at all levels of internal and external organisations.
- Accountability for the cost models associated with the proposed solution.
- Leading the internal Solution and Delivery approval processes, ensuring appropriate briefings and stakeholder management activities have been undertaken in advance of formal approval gates.
